How do I choose the right drawbar?
It's essential to choose a drawbar compatible with your specific machine tool and chuck combination. Check the chuck product description, and you will know which one you need. -
A drawbar is a vital part of a workholding system, responsible for securely gripping the tool in place. It acts like a clamp, using force to hold the toolholder or workpiece tightly within the chuck.
